For the new 2018 W-4 form, do I also print out the separate A-H worksheet and fill that out for my employer?
No, an employee is not required to give the separate worksheet to the employer. Keep it for your own records.

What is the right way to fill out Two-Earners Worksheet tax form?
Wages, in this context, are what you expect to appear in box 1 of your W-2.The IRS recommends that the additional withholding be applied to the higher-paid spouse and that the lesser-paid spouse should simply claim zero withholding allowances, as this is usually more accurate (due to the way that withholding is actually calculated by payroll programs, you may wind up with less withheld than you want if you split it).

How do I fill out the SS-4 form for a new Delaware C-Corp to get an EIN?
You indicate this is a Delaware C Corp so check corporation and you will file Form 1120.Check that you are starting a new corporation.Date business started is the date you actually started the business. Typically you would look on the paperwork from Delaware and put the date of incorporation.December is the standard closing month for most corporations. Unless you have a signNow business reason to pick a different month use Dec.If you plan to pay yourself wages put one. If you don't know put zero.Unless you are fairly sure you will owe payroll taxes the first year check that you will not have payroll or check that your liability will be less than $1,000. Anything else and the IRS will expect you to file quarterly payroll tax returns.Indicate the type of SaaS services you will offer.

How can I figure out what genre I enjoy reading, and find books in that genre to read?
The t.v. and movies you enjoy watching can give you a clue as to what genre of books you will enjoy reading.What kind of crime shows do you enjoy watching. Would you prefer Psych or True Dectective? If it is Psych, then you probably prefer cosy crime books, if you prefer True Dectective you probably enjoy dark psychological crime books.If you like Sci-fi, do you prefer Firefly or Star Trek. Firefly leans more towards dystopian sci-fi, while Star trek is more optimistic.I would then check out sites like Goodreads for recommendations. Thrillers You Must Read!What I tend to do is have two windows open, one on Amazon and the other on Goodreads. I read the blurbs on Goodreads and then I search the book on Amazon. I read the free sample, and if at the end of the sample I am dying to keep going, then I buy the book. I would recommend that you do that until something really catches your imagination and sucks you in.

How do we identify a genre?
Definition of Genre. Genre means a type of art, literature, or music characterized by a specific form, content, and style. For example, literature has four main genres: poetry, drama, fiction, and non-fiction. All of these genres have particular features and functions that distinguish them from one another.

Is a letter a genre?
Private letters as a literary genre are perhaps closest to essay, that which is literally 'to try.' They try to communicate; they're a genre for pleasure and leisure; meandering is tolerated, even welcome. ... Essay, memoir, fiction, creative nonfiction, diary even, they can all be there in letters.
